Compared to last sale: Feeder cattle were too lightly tested to develop any market trend. Demand for feeders was mostly good to very good for light offerings. Quality was mostly plain to average today. Most feeders were offered in small groups. Buyers showed very good demand for limited feeders. Market activity was mostly moderate to active with several buyers actively bidding on limited offerings. Weigh up cows sold on good to very good demand for moderate offerings. Additional packer buyers were in the market again this week. Slaughter cows sold mostly steady to 2.00 higher on breaking and boning cows, lean cows sold generally steady in a narrow comparison. Feeding cows sold mostly steady to 3.00 higher. Packers and feeding buyers both showed very good demand for high quality cows suitable to feed. Quality was mostly average to attractive this sale. Weigh up conditions were mostly average to above average, however weigh conditions were not as as attractive to buyers this week as very warm temperatures had most cows and bulls tanked up on water. Slaughter bulls sold unevenly steady from 3.00 lower to 4.00 higher. Feeding bull buyers caused average dressing bulls to sell higher while bulls too big to feed sold mostly 3.00. Feeding bulls sold mostly 5.00-8.00 higher. Bull quality this sale was average to attractive. Young age cows suitable to feed or rebreed sold generally steady. Quality was mostly average to attractive, however fewer takers were seen for this class of cow. Fewer buyers looking for rebreed offerings were seen this sale as most of the rebreeds from this point on will be late April and later calvers.

What does "Medium and Large 1" mean?

USDA feeder grades describe frame size and muscle thickness, not quality of the individual animal. "Medium and Large" is the frame score; the number is muscle (1 = heaviest muscled). "Medium and Large 1–2" pens mix both muscle scores — common across the Southeast.

What is $/cwt?

Dollars per hundredweight — per 100 lb of animal. A 500-lb calf at $450/cwt brings 5 × $450 = $2,250. Lighter cattle usually bring more per cwt but less per head.

Why are some prices per head?

Bred cows, cow-calf pairs, and some replacement classes sell by the head, not by weight. We show those exactly as USDA reports them — a $/head figure is never converted into $/cwt on this site.

Where do these numbers come from?

From the USDA Agricultural Marketing Service's Livestock Market News — federal reporters at the sale. We publish each report in full and link the official USDA document at the top of the page.
